2005 Washington Revised Code RCW 9.40.105: Tampering with fire alarm or fire fighting equipment — Intent to commit arson — Penalty.

    Any person who willfully and without cause tampers with, molests, injures, or breaks any public or private fire alarm apparatus, emergency phone, radio, or other wire or signal, or any fire fighting equipment with the intent to commit arson, is guilty of a class B felony punishable according to chapter 9A.20 RCW.

    [2003 c 53 § 24.]
